
/*-------------------------------------------------
----------------PAGINAS SECUNDARIAS----------------
-------------------------------------------------*/

#paginas { position:relative; width:450px; }

.tamanhoFonte { color:#6d84af; font-size:11px; font-weight:bold; text-align:right; width:440px; height:30px; margin-top:-10px; }

.elementos-pagina_tab { position:relative; width:414px; margin:0 0 0 27px; color:#00318e; text-align:justify; line-height:22px; }

.elementos-pagina_tab p { margin:8px 0 0 0; }

.elementos-pagina { position:relative; width:425px; margin:0 0 0 12px; color:#00318e; text-align:justify; line-height:22px; }

.elementos-pagina_2 { position:relative; width:425px; margin:0 0 0 12px; color:#00318e; text-align:justify; line-height:22px; }

.define-tamanho1 { height:550px; }

.elementos-pagina p { margin:8px 0 0 0; }

.texto-azul { color:#00318e; }

.texto-miudo { line-height:14px; font-size:10px; }

.texto-vermelho { color:#dd3933; }

.titulo-vermelho { color:#dd3933; font-size:14px; font-weight:bold; text-transform:uppercase; left:-16px; }

.links-internos { color:#dd3933; text-decoration:underline; }

.link-internos-ligacao:hover { text-decoration:underline; }

.link-depoimento { font-size:11px; float: right; display:block; }

.link-depoimento:hover { color:#666666; }

.imagem-paginas { width:430px; height:100%; text-align:center; position:relative; left:0; margin:22px 0 0 0; }

.barra-imagem { width:100%; height:6px; background-image:url(../images/line-imagens.jpg); background-repeat:repeat-x; margin-bottom:10px; }

.paraf_1 { position:relative; left:15px; width:409px; }

.bulet-titulo { background-image:url(../images/bulet-titulo.gif); background-repeat:no-repeat; background-position:0 3px; width:100%; height:100%; padding:0 0 0 16px; position:relative; left:-18px; }

.bulet-titulo2 { background-image:url(../images/bulet-titulo.gif); background-repeat:no-repeat; background-position:0 3px; width:100%; height:100%; padding:0 0 0 16px; position:relative; left:0; }

.bulet-texto { background-image:url(../images/bulet-textos.gif); background-repeat:no-repeat; background-position:0 9px; width:100%; height:100%; padding:0 0 0 15px; position:relative; }

.ponto-divisao { background-image:url(../images/ponto.gif); background-repeat:repeat-x; height:3px; width:430px; clear:both; }

.link-voltar:hover { text-decoration:underline; }

/*--titulo quem somos --*/
#quem-somos { position:relative; width:450px; height:47px; }

#quem-somos h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/quem-somos.gif); background-repeat:no-repeat; background-position:3px 4px; }

#quem-somos h2 span { width:60px; float:left; }

#quem-somos h2 .barra-titulo { float:right; width:320px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o missao/visao --*/
#missao-visao { position:relative; width:450px; height:47px; }

#missao-visao h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/missao-visao.gif); background-repeat:no-repeat; background-position:3px 4px; }

#missao-visao h2 span { width:60px; float:left; }

#missao-visao h2 .barra-titulo { float:right; width:300px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o metodologia --*/
#metodologia { position:relative; width:450px; height:47px; }

#metodologia h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/metodologia.gif); background-repeat:no-repeat; background-position:3px 4px; }

#metodologia h2 span { width:60px; float:left; }

#metodologia h2 .barra-titulo { float:right; width:229px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o equipe-academica --*/
#equipe-academica { position:relative; width:450px; height:47px; }

#equipe-academica h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/equipe-academica.gif); background-repeat:no-repeat; background-position:3px 4px; }

#equipe-academica h2 span { width:60px; float:left; }

#equipe-academica h2 .barra-titulo { float:right; width:282px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o quadro-digital --*/
#quadro-digital { position:relative; width:450px; height:47px; }

#quadro-digital h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/quadro-digital.gif); background-repeat:no-repeat; background-position:3px 4px; }

#quadro-digital h2 span { width:60px; float:left; }

#quadro-digital h2 .barra-titulo { float:right; width:236px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o responsabilidade social --*/
#responsabilidade { position:relative; width:450px; height:47px; }

#responsabilidade h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/responsabilidade-social.gif); background-repeat:no-repeat; background-position:3px 4px; }

#responsabilidade h2 span { width:60px; float:left; }

#responsabilidade h2 .barra-titulo { float:right; width:206px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}


/*--titulo cursos --*/
#cursos { position:relative; width:450px; height:47px; }

#cursos h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/cursos.gif); background-repeat:no-repeat; background-position:3px 4px; }

#cursos h2 span { width:60px; float:left; }

#cursos h2 .barra-titulo { float:right; width:362px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

.bloco-links-cursos { width:400px; }

.bloco-links-cursos ul { width:380px; margin-top:5px; margin-bottom:20px; padding-left:5px; }

.bloco-links-cursos ul li { width:250px; }

.bloco-links-cursos ul li a { width:200px; height:20px; padding:0 0 0 10px; background-image:url(../images/bulet-seta.gif); background-repeat:no-repeat; background-position: 0 6px; }

.bloco-links-cursos ul li a:hover { background-image:url(../images/bulet-seta-on.gif); text-decoration:underline; }

/* links de curso opcoes 2*/
.bloco-links-int { position:relative; float:left; width:215px; height:95px; top:40px; left:10px; }

.bloco-links-int ul { position:absolute; width:190px; height:95px; top:0px; left:30px; }

.bloco-links-int ul li { width:160px; }

.bloco-links-int ul li a { display:block; width:190px; height:20px; padding:0 0 0 10px; background-image:url(../images/bulet-seta.gif); background-repeat:no-repeat; background-position: 0 6px; }

.bloco-links-int ul li a:hover { background-image:url(../images/bulet-seta-on.gif); text-decoration:underline; }

/* fim links de curso opcoes 2*/


/* OLD-OLD-OLD-OLD links de cursos opcoes OLD-OLD-OLD-OLD*/

.opcoes-links { width:426px; height:40px; cursor:pointer; position:relative; margin:10px 0 10px 0; }

/* cursos criancas */

#crianca_playlearn { width:426px; height:40px; background-image:url(../images/cursos-playnlearn_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#crianca_playlearn span { position:absolute; left: 128px; top: 9px; }

#crianca_playlearn:hover { background-image:url(../images/cursos-playnlearn_on.gif); color:#dd3832; }

#crianca_prekids { width:426px; height:40px; background-image:url(../images/cursos-prekids_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#crianca_prekids span { position:absolute; left: 98px; top: 9px; }

#crianca_prekids:hover { background-image:url(../images/cursos-prekids_on.gif); color:#dd3832; }

#crianca_kids { width:426px; height:40px; background-image:url(../images/cursos-kids_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#crianca_kids span { position:absolute; left: 63px; top: 9px; }

#crianca_kids:hover { background-image:url(../images/cursos-kids_on.gif); color:#dd3832; }

#crianca_junior { width:426px; height:40px; background-image:url(../images/cursos-junior_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#crianca_junior span { position:absolute; left: 76px; top: 9px; }

#crianca_junior:hover { background-image:url(../images/cursos-junior_on.gif); color:#dd3832; }

/* cursos jovens adultos */

#jovens_regular { width:426px; height:40px; background-image:url(../images/cursos-regular_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#jovens_regular span { position:absolute; left: 128px; top: 9px; }

#jovens_regular:hover { background-image:url(../images/cursos-regular_on.gif); color:#dd3832; }

/* cursos intensivos */

#intensivos_intensive { width:426px; height:40px; background-image:url(../images/cursos-intensive_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#intensivos_intensive span { position:absolute; left: 128px; top: 9px; }

#intensivos_intensive:hover { background-image:url(../images/cursos-intensive_on.gif); color:#dd3832; }

#intensivos_corporate { width:426px; height:40px; background-image:url(../images/cursos-corporate_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#intensivos_corporate span { position:absolute; left: 128px; top: 9px; }

#intensivos_corporate:hover { background-image:url(../images/cursos-corporate_on.gif); color:#dd3832; }

/* cursos conversacao */

#conversacao_conversation { width:426px; height:40px; background-image:url(../images/cursos-conversation_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#conversacao_conversation span { position:absolute; left: 128px; top: 9px; }

#conversacao_conversation:hover { background-image:url(../images/cursos-conversation_on.gif); color:#dd3832; }

#conversacao_teatalk { width:426px; height:40px; background-image:url(../images/cursos-teatalk_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#conversacao_teatalk span { position:absolute; left: 128px; top: 9px; }

#conversacao_teatalk:hover { background-image:url(../images/cursos-teatalk_on.gif); color:#dd3832; }

/* cursos especiais */

#especiais_ase { width:426px; height:40px; background-image:url(../images/cursos-ase_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#especiais_ase span { position:absolute; left: 68px; top: 9px; }

#especiais_ase:hover { background-image:url(../images/cursos-ase_on.gif); color:#dd3832; }

#especiais_ttc { width:426px; height:40px; background-image:url(../images/cursos-ttc_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#especiais_ttc span { position:absolute; left: 68px; top: 9px; }

#especiais_ttc:hover { background-image:url(../images/cursos-ttc_on.gif); color:#dd3832; }

#especiais_translation { width:426px; height:40px; background-image:url(../images/cursos-translation_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#especiais_translation span { position:absolute; left: 128px; top: 9px; }

#especiais_translation:hover { background-image:url(../images/cursos-translation_on.gif); color:#dd3832; }

#especiais_portuguese { width:426px; height:40px; background-image:url(../images/cursos-portuguese_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#especiais_portuguese span { position:absolute; left: 128px; top: 9px; }

#especiais_portuguese:hover { background-image:url(../images/cursos-portuguese_on.gif); color:#dd3832; }

/* fim links de cursos opcoes */

.box-comentarios { width:406px; background-color:#e7eaeb; color:#00318e; padding:12px; margin:10px 0 10px 0; font-style:italic; text-align:center; }

.box-depoimentos { padding:5px 16px 5px 16px; }

.box-aulas-cursos { margin-top:20px; margin-bottom:20px; background-color:#f0f2f4; width:430px; height: 25px; position:relative; }

.box-aulas-cursos span { position:absolute; width: 430px; text-align:center; top:1px; }

/*--titulo unidades --*/
#unidades { position:relative; width:450px; height:47px; }

#unidades h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/unidades.gif); background-repeat:no-repeat; background-position:3px 4px; }

#unidades h2 span { width:60px; float:left; }

#unidades h2 .barra-titulo { float:right; width:346px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

#unidade_largo { width:426px; height:40px; background-image:url(../images/unidade-largo_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#unidade_largo span { position:absolute; left: 128px; top: 9px; }

#unidade_largo:hover { background-image:url(../images/unidade-largo_on.gif); color:#dd3832; }

#unidade_lido { width:426px; height:40px; background-image:url(../images/unidade-lido_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#unidade_lido span { position:absolute; left: 128px; top: 9px; }

#unidade_lido:hover { background-image:url(../images/unidade-lido_on.gif); color:#dd3832; }

#unidade_saens { width:426px; height:40px; background-image:url(../images/unidade-saens_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#unidade_saens span { position:absolute; left: 128px; top: 9px; }

#unidade_saens:hover { background-image:url(../images/unidade-saens_on.gif); color:#dd3832; }

/*------------------------------------------------*/

/*--titulo teste ingles --*/
#teste-ingles { position:relative; width:450px; height:47px; }

#teste-ingles h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/teste-ingles.gif); background-repeat:no-repeat; background-position:3px 4px; }

#teste-ingles h2 span { width:60px; float:left; }

#teste-ingles h2 .barra-titulo { float:right; width:293px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/* pg-inicio teste ingles */

#ti-elementary { width:426px; height:40px; background-image:url(../images/ti-elementary_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#ti-elementary:hover { background-image:url(../images/ti-elementary_on.gif); }

#ti-intermediate { width:426px; height:40px; background-image:url(../images/ti-intermediate_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#ti-intermediate:hover { background-image:url(../images/ti-intermediate_on.gif); }

#ti-pre-intermediate { width:426px; height:40px; background-image:url(../images/ti-pre-intermediate_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#ti-pre-intermediate:hover { background-image:url(../images/ti-pre-intermediate_on.gif); }

#ti-upper-intermediate { width:426px; height:40px; background-image:url(../images/ti-upper-intermediate_off.gif); background-repeat:no-repeat; background-position:21px 10px; position:relative; }

#ti-upper-intermediate:hover { background-image:url(../images/ti-upper-intermediate_on.gif); }

/*------------------------------------------------*/
/*--titulo franquias --*/
#franquias { position:relative; width:450px; height:47px; }

#franquias h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/franquias.gif); background-repeat:no-repeat; background-position:3px 4px; }

#franquias h2 span { width:60px; float:left; }

#franquias h2 .barra-titulo { float:right; width:340px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o matricula online --*/
#matricula { position:relative; width:450px; height:47px; }

#matricula h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/matricula-online.gif); background-repeat:no-repeat; background-position:3px 4px; }

#matricula h2 span { width:60px; float:left; }

#matricula h2 .barra-titulo { float:right; width:295px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o fale com a diretora --*/
#fale-diretora { position:relative; width:450px; height:47px; }

#fale-diretora h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/fale-diretora.gif); background-repeat:no-repeat; background-position:3px 4px; }

#fale-diretora h2 span { width:60px; float:left; }

#fale-diretora h2 .barra-titulo { float:right; width:273px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o trabalhe conosco --*/
#trabalhe-conosco { position:relative; width:450px; height:47px; }

#trabalhe-conosco h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/trabalhe-conosco.gif); background-repeat:no-repeat; background-position:3px 4px; }

#trabalhe-conosco h2 span { width:60px; float:left; }

#trabalhe-conosco h2 .barra-titulo { float:right; width:273px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*--titulo calendario2009 --*/
#calendario { position:relative; width:450px; height:47px; }

#calendario h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/calendario.gif); background-repeat:no-repeat; background-position:3px 4px; }

#calendario h2 span { width:60px; float:left; }

#calendario h2 .barra-titulo { float:right; width:294px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}


/*--titulo self access --*/
#self { position:relative; width:450px; height:47px; }

#self h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/self-access.gif); background-repeat:no-repeat; background-position:3px 4px; }

#self h2 span { width:60px; float:left; }

#self h2 .barra-titulo { float:right; width:258px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}


/*--titulo promocoes --*/
#promocoes { position:relative; width:450px; height:47px; }

#promocoes h2 { position:absolute; width:430px; height:25px; left:10px; background-image:url(../images/promocoes.gif); background-repeat:no-repeat; background-position:3px 4px; }

#promocoes h2 span { width:60px; float:left; }

#promocoes h2 .barra-titulo { float:right; width:318px; height:25px; background-image:url(../images/line-titulo.jpg); background-repeat:repeat-x; background-position:0 11px; }

/*------------------------------------------------*/
/*--NOTÍCIA --*/

#texto-noticia { position:relative; width:430px; margin-left:13px; }

#texto-noticia .data { font-size:12px; color:#999999; height:20px; }

#texto-noticia .titulo { font-size:16px; font-weight:bold; height:30px; }

#texto-noticia .texto { font-size:14px; }

/*--BUSCA --*/



/*extar*/

.forcar_espaco { letter-spacing:-1px; }
